Difference between Boston Bruins and NHL Winter Classic

Boston Bruins vs. NHL Winter Classic

The Boston Bruins are a professional ice hockey team based in Boston. The NHL Winter Classic is one of the three series of regular season outdoor games played in the National Hockey League (NHL), and is distinct from the league's other two series, the NHL Heritage Classic and the NHL Stadium Series.
